One of the strongest ways to eliminate a bad habit is to replace it instead of remove it. So, in the case of a food addiction, eating something healthy and enjoyable is better than just trying to avoid something negative. The same is true for gambling. If the habit is to go to the casino every night after work, choose instead to meet a friend for dinner, see a movie or involve yourself in a charity you enjoy. Even better, surround yourself with others who know what you’re going through and will be supportive and encouraging. This is possibly the most important thing of all – get help and get involved.
